The Carlton house is just "Grandma & Grandpa Giberson's house" to me. And to any other grandkids born before 1995. It is still unreal to me that there are some of my cousins who never visited this house, or maybe were to little to remember it. It makes me so sad that some did not ever know her here on Earth. But I know we all have pictures, memories and stories to share with them. I have learned so much more just from this blog alone, thanks Aunt Judy for starting it.
My kids will not know her the way I did, but they will come to know more about her as they grow and why they each carry a part of her name in theirs.
